Today (November 6, 2023) I was thinking about Carolyn and found her obituary when I did an online search. I first met Carolyn in 1992 through Robert Rust Sr. and another retired Eastern Airlines captain whose name escapes me at the moment. At the time Mr. Rust held the US type certificate for the DeHavilland of Canada Chipmunk aerobatic trainer. Carolyn owned one that was undergoing a restoration. Carolyn learned I had my pilots license, and she invited me several times to fly with her in her Stearman biplane. She even let me fly the airplane (it flew like a truck with no power steering, and visibility was blocked by those flat wings. Still, I'll never forget the experience of flying in an open-cockpit, feeling the cold air on my face, and hearing the "wind in the wires" (the whistling of the wing bracing wires as the airplane moved through the air). I also greatly appreciate her invitations to dinner at her house with her husband, meeting Rowdy, their Jack Russel terrier, and allowing me to adopt two cats from their farm. Carolyn was a gracious woman, and I will miss her.

I met Carolyn back many years ago in Griffin. We met because of horses, of course. I ended up feeding horses on her farm, pushing my three year old daughter in the wheelbarrow. That soon morphed into helping with the breeding and sometimes spending nights with Carolyn in the barn ,waiting for foals to be born.
Before long, she also had me and my big buckskin horse going over the jumps in the field and joining the Tri-County foxhunting club where she was the "huntsman". Because of her, I became a "whipper-in", helping hunt the hounds and fulfilling a lifelong dream . This period in my life was amazing because of my friendship with Carolyn and our shared love of horses. She was a great rider and her knowledge of horses was outstanding. I learned so much from her.
